IT基础架构是指用于支持企业信息系统运行的一系列硬件、软件、网络等基本设施和资源。这些基础设施能够提供稳定可靠的运行环境,保障信息系统的安全性和可用性。IT基础架构模块包括了多个重要的模块,本文将详细介绍其中的几个模块,并提供相应的代码示例。 ## 1. 网络模块 网络模块是IT基础架构中最基本的模块之一。它提供了企业内部和外部的网络连接,包括局域网(LAN)、广域网(WAN)等。网络模块通过
原创 2023-11-29 14:09:27
189阅读
我们又迎来了技术进步的崭新一年,以下是我对基础架构、物联网、大数据和云领域重大进展的一些看法。1.大数据的运用因预装解决方案而变得更加容易,受监管行业有了新选择。Wikibon首席研究官Peter Burris认为,大数据复杂性是许多企业普遍担心的问题。大数据工具的范围和性质要求IT部门必须花费过多的时间管理相关技术,而不能将时间用于探索更多价值。大数据平台常常是由许多不同供应商的产品拼凑而成,这
拓扑这个名词是从几何学中借用来的。网络拓扑是网络形状,或者是网络在物理上的连通性。网络拓扑结构是指用传输媒体互连各种设备的物理布局,即用什么方式把网络中的计算机等设备连接起来。拓扑图给出网络服务器、工作站的网络配置和相互间的连接。网络的拓扑结构有很多种,主要有星型结构、环型结构、总线结构、分布式结构、树型结构、网状结构、蜂窝状结构、混合型结构等。1、星型结构星型结构是最古老的一种连接方式,大家每天
每一个模式描述了一个在我们周围不断重复发生的问题及该问题解决方案的核心。这样,你就能一次又一次地使用该方案而不必做重复工作。网站架构模式分层分层是企业应用系统中最常见的一种架构模式,将系统在横向维度上切分成几个部分,每个部分负责一部分相对比较单一的职责,然后通过上层对下层的依赖和调用组成一个完整的系统。在大型网站架构中采用分层结构,将网站软件分为应用层、服务层、数据层。应用层负责具体业务和视图展示
以业务需求和场景为中心,以先进的云原生技术为手段,广泛借鉴头部大厂的各种最佳实践,各厂基础架构部与云厂商、开源社区密切分工协作,新一代云原生架构的变革定会快速推进,给各厂带来巨大的回报。 一、背景 受持续不断的疫情、toC 市场用户到顶、股市波动等因素影响,各厂基础架构部从疫情前的快速扩张模式,转向维持或者收缩模式。但服务还在运行,工作还要继续
原文地址:http://mobile.51cto.com/abased-386212.htm 关于Android架构,因为手机的限制,目前我觉得也确实没什么大谈特谈的,但是从开发的角度,看到整齐的代码,优美的分层总是一种舒服的享受的。 从艺术的角度看,其实我们是在追求一种美。 本文先分析几个当今比较流行的android软件包,最后我们汲取其中觉得优秀的部分,搭建我们自己的通用android工程模板
转载 2023-08-26 13:21:37
85阅读
基础技术分为两部分:编程和系统编程部分C语言:接近底层,内存管理更直接,掌握程序的运行情况。《C程序设计语言(第2版)》,学习 C语言精细控制底层资源,如内存管理、文件操作、网络通信汇编语言:可以深入了解计算机怎么运行,针对lock free之类高并发,可以更好的理解和思考编程范式:有助于培养抽象思维,提高编程效率,提高程序的结构合理性、可读性、可维护性,降低冗余,提高运行效率。面向对象编程(C+
IT信息基础架构 接下来我们将围绕着下一代IT信息基础架构进行讨论说明。将从计算、网络、存储和安全四个方面进行展开。计算 从传统物理机到虚拟化,再从虚拟化到上云。计算资源从固定采购到按需采购,大大地降低了企业在IT设施的投入。上云又分成两种,企业自建私有云和使用公有云。私有云私有云的代表产品就是OpenStack,国内很多公有云就是直接基于OpenStack开发的。公有云公有云做的比较好的有AWS
一、基础架构数据库产品中架构分为应用层、逻辑层、物理层。应用层:负责和客户端、用户进行交互,需要和不同的客户端和中间服务器进行交互,建立连接,记住连接的转台,响应他们的全球,发挥数据和控制信息(错误信息、状态码等)。逻辑层:负责具体的查询处理、事务管理、存储管理、回复管理,以及其他的附加功能。查询处理器负责查询的解析、执行。当接受到客户端到查询是,数据库就会分配一个线程来处理它。先由查询处理器(优
网络攻击每天都在发生。事实上,每天有超2000次的攻击是针对连接了互联网且未受保护的系统,大概每39s就会发生一次。网络攻击导致的数据泄露、敏感信息被盗、财务损失、声誉受损都给企业及个人带来威胁。随着各大企业对数字系统的依赖,网络威胁已成为当下面临的主要挑战。实现IT基础架构安全的4个层面安全团队使用多种策略来保护企业设备和系统免受物理和数字威胁,通常会通过4个层面的管理来保障IT基础架构安全:1
Scrapy不是一个函数功能库,而是一个爬虫框架。Scrapy爬虫框架包含7个部分,即5+2结构:5个框架主体部分,2个中间键。5个模块engine模块已有实现。整个框架的核心,控制所有模块之间的数据流,任何模块模块之间的数据流动都要经过engine模块的调度。根据条件触发事件;根据各个模块提供的事件进行触发。scheduler模块已有实现。对所有的爬取请求进行调度管理。假如有许多请求,哪些先访
转载 2023-08-09 23:07:28
90阅读
企业在发展过程中,需要对 IT 基础架构进行扩展,凡是涉及到基础架构的变更对整个 IT 应用环境都会带来一系列的改变。我们对 IT 基础架构分为网络和后台服务器应用,为保证 IT 系统正常运维,这两个方面是我们要考虑的重点。网络是 IT 应用的接入平台,包括: DHCP 分配 IP 地址, DNS 地址
转载 2023-09-08 06:48:20
86阅读
公司使用的项目管理系统2009年立项,经过2010年开发2011年上线,时至今日已是2年有余。随着公司规模扩大、组织调整,还有日新月异的技术,要求我们要重新审视此系统的架构。公司IT环境共拥有近20套应用系统,已从原来大部分采购的局面,到了现在超过半数都是自己开发的情况。随着系统各方面需求不断提高,系统与系统之间的交互愈发复杂,我们也在寻找更好的IT架构方式,打算以项目信息管理系统为出发点,进行新
  
转载 2018-04-26 09:13:00
86阅读
一、计算机网络体系结构什么是计算机网络将分散、独立的计算机系统通过通信设备和线路连接起来的功能完善的资源共享和信息传递系统。计算机网络的功能(1)资源共享(2)数据通信(3)分布式处理计算机网络的结构ISP结构:因特网服务提供者/因特网服务提供商,是一个向广大用户综合提供互联网接入业务、信息业务、和增值业务的公司,如中国电信、中国联动、中国移动等。分为主干ISP、地区ISP和本地ISP。计算机网络
转载 2023-08-15 12:37:23
2835阅读
wordpress最佳架构 KeystoneJS是一个内容管理系统和框架,用于构建与数据库交互的服务器应用程序。 它基于Node.js的Express框架 ,并使用MongoDB进行数据存储。 对于想要构建数据驱动网站但不想进入PHP平台或WordPress之类的大型系统的Web开发人员,它代表了CMS替代方案。 尽管可以不是由技术用户来设置WordPress,但KeystoneJS提供了专业人
# 服务器虚拟化架构模型教学 ## 一、整体流程 ```mermaid flowchart TD A[了解服务器虚拟化架构模型] --> B[确定需要使用的架构模型] B --> C[实现架构模型] ``` ## 二、具体步骤 ### 1. 了解服务器虚拟化架构模型 在实现服务器虚拟化之前,首先需要了解不同的架构模型,比如全虚拟化、半虚拟化等。 ### 2. 确定需要使
原创 2024-04-27 05:43:18
44阅读
摘要:本文描述了在用VS.NET进行B/S开发时采用的框架结构,一般建立类库项目和Web项目,在Web基本aspx页面类中调用类库中方法,同时在aspx页面类中不需要写任何对数据库操作的SQL代码,便于分层开发和代码维护。1、概述使用微软Visual Studio .NET进行B/S或者C/S结构应用程序开发,为了使软件分层开发和易维护原则,将整个项目框架分为类库和应用程序两个项目。在应用程序中调
1、什么是架构架构本质  在软件行业,对于什么是架构,都有很多的争论,每个人都有自己的理解。   此君说的架构和彼君理解的架构未必是一回事。LInux有架构,MySQL有架构,JVM也有架构,使用Java开发、MySQL存储、跑在Linux上的业务系统也有架构,应该关注哪一个?想要清楚以上问题需要梳理几个有关系又相似的概念:系统与子系统、模块与组建、框架与架构:&n
转载 2023-07-13 10:46:10
18阅读
架构 架构一般来说意味着:从最高层将系统分解成多个部分。一旦作出就很难改变的决定。Ralph Johnson说: 架构是一种主观 的东西,是项目专家开发人员对系统设计的一种共同理解 。通常,共同理解是指系统包含哪些主要组件以及这些组件相互之间如何交互。Martin认为架构模式中最重要就是分层 。企业应用程序 企 业应用程序通常也被称为"信息系统(Information Systems)"或
  • 1
  • 2
  • 3
  • 4
  • 5